* The report grid relies on a stable sort so rows with equal
 * primary keys keep their ingestion order across exports. Our
 * previous comparator delegated to the platform sort, which is
 * not guaranteed stable on all runtimes, and customers noticed
 * rows shuffling between otherwise identical PDF exports. This
 * constant defines the secondary tiebreak key applied after the
 * user-selected column. Do not remove it, even if tests pass
 * locally. The regression was first isolated in the build whose
 * token is noted below. */

trace token, bagug-tadup: htk6_fc0fc4

Hey — quick handover on Quotaline before my trip. Per-tenant rate quotas moved off the shared pool last Tuesday, so each tenant now has its own bucket. Big tenants (Marwick, Ostrel) were grandfathered at higher limits. If someone pages about 429s, check their tier first. The current quota settings in prod are as follows.

settings of tagef-bawif:
DRUIX_HOST=druix.zemvarlabs.internal
DRUIX_PORT=8000

CharSniff detects encodings on uploaded text files for the Quillbase import pipeline. Review before deploy: SNIFF_MAX_BYTES caps sampling at 64KB; raising it increases memory exposure per request. SNIFF_FALLBACK must stay at utf-8 — latin-1 fallback reintroduced the mojibake injection issue from the last audit. Confidence threshold SNIFF_MIN_CONF below 0.7 is not approved. The service reports detection metrics to the Quillbase telemetry collector over mutual auth, and its credential is set on the next line of the env file.

vault entry, yahif-yajep: COURIER_KEY29=b802bdf8034096b65a51c6ba5abe2

INTERNAL MEMO — Branch Managers, Corvass Trading. Effective the first of next month, the sales-commission scheme changes: base rate drops from 4% to 3%, with a 2% accelerator on deals above quota. Renewals now count at half weight. Payout moves to quarterly. Brief your teams this week; HR will circulate calculators. The change reflects where the company is heading, as noted confidentially below.

confidential, kagep-kahof: Druokax Systems plans to lower the Ulaath list price by 53 percent in March.